'America' is beautiful for History
"America: The Story of Us" launched Sunday to the highest ratings for any special in the cabler's history, giving the channel its best night ever in primetime.
"America" drew 2.6 million viewers in the 18-49 demo and 5.7 million overall.
The series will run for four more Sundays before concluding Memorial Day, May 31. The upcoming second episode focuses on westward expansion and growing divisions between the North and South. (Pic above is the special's depiction of Valley Forge.)Former Discovery and BBC2 topper Jane Root exec produces "America" through her Nutopia production company.
History's "Pawn Stars," which aired firstrun episodes before "America," averaged 5.0 million total viewers, up more than 25% from its season-two average.
